United States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it

August Term 2022 Argued: November 23, 2022 Decided: January 30, 2023

No. 21-0707

UNITED STATES OF AMERICA, Appellee, v. KHAWAJA MUHAMMAD FAROOQ, Defendant-Appellant.

On Appeal from the United States District Court for the Eastern District of New York

Before: KEARSE, PARK, and MENASHI, Circuit Judges.

Defendant-Appellant Khawaja Muhammad Farooq pled guilty to one count of extortion under 18 U.S.C. § 875(d) for threatening to disseminate nude photographs of Jane Doe if she did not return to a relationship with him. Farooq now appeals, arguing that the plea proceedings were defective because the district court did not explain the “wrongfulness” element of extortion under United States v.
